Transaction 64c1684e0866b0fc83ed2c4e5bd53136a5ee8a1878367241d1dd8b28430b89e4

1 Input
2 Outputs
  • 64c1684e0866b0fc83ed2c4e5bd53136a5ee8a1878367241d1dd8b28430b89e4:0
  • value  720910
    address  13bsCJ86oSSHDv97VvSH684SqAwQLT7jjt
  • 64c1684e0866b0fc83ed2c4e5bd53136a5ee8a1878367241d1dd8b28430b89e4:1
  • value  270724
    address  1EzSf1pgXz1KeRRHDydoc7UQgXibLjfJmL